10 Gbit/s transmission over 700 km of standard single mode fibre with a 10 cm chirped fibre grating compensator and duobinary transmitter

摘要

The advent of Er-doped fibre amplifiers makes optical fibre transmission in the 1.55 /spl mu/m wavelength window very attractive. However, with the large amounts of standard non-dispersion shifted fibres (NDSF) already installed, high bit rate transmission is restricted by the large dispersion of these fibres at 1.55 /spl mu/m, unless compensating techniques are used. A number of approaches have been put forward to address this issue. Of these, fibre gratings are attractive as they are passive, linear devices, highly dispersive yet compact and relatively easy to fabricate in large numbers. We demonstrate that 10 Gbit/s transmission up to 700 km of NDSF is achievable with a single 10 cm long chirped fibre grating in combination with a reduced bandwidth phase-alternating duobinary transmitter.
